I suggest that gluing it is a bad idea. The moment of your force when pushing and shoving after a tough night out finished off by a curry could break the glue and lead to a very messy situation!!
Seriously, you need about size 6 by 100MM screws. I'd imagine your upstairs toilets are wooden floors unless you're in an apartment block. Bear in mind that you'll get away without lifting the toilet if it is over wood as you can screw into wood without drilling, but the last few turns will take it out of you big time. Having said that, personally I would think you should lift the toilet and pre drill as its so much easier.
If its over concrete, to get plugs in you have to remove the toilet. Doing this will be far more work that the 2 screws! make sure you drill in exactly the right place!!
